Firstly, it is essential to understand the weight limits for packing boxes. Standard cardboard boxes come in various sizes, but a general guideline is to keep the weight of each box under 50 pounds. Exceeding this weight can make it challenging to lift and transport the boxes safely. Therefore, it is crucial to weigh your books and calculate the total weight before packing them into a box. Using a digital scale can help determine the weight accurately.
When selecting boxes for packing books, opt for smaller boxes rather than larger ones. Smaller boxes are easier to handle and can help prevent overpacking. A common mistake is to use large boxes, which can lead to an overwhelming number of books being crammed into one container. Instead, consider using medium-sized boxes that can hold around 15 to 20 books, depending on their size and weight. This approach allows for better weight distribution and easier lifting.
Another effective strategy is to organize books by size and weight before packing. Grouping heavier books together and placing them at the bottom of the box can create a stable foundation. Lighter books can be placed on top to prevent crushing and damage. Additionally, this method ensures that the weight is evenly distributed throughout the box, reducing the risk of exceeding the weight limit.
Using packing materials can also help in avoiding overweight boxes. Utilizing packing paper, bubble wrap, or even old newspapers can fill empty spaces and prevent books from shifting during transit. However, it is essential not to overdo it with packing materials, as they can add unnecessary weight. Instead, use lightweight materials that provide adequate protection without significantly increasing the overall weight of the box.
Labeling boxes is another crucial aspect of the packing process. By clearly marking each box with its contents and weight, you can keep track of what is inside and ensure that no box exceeds the weight limit. This practice also aids in organizing books when they reach their destination, making unpacking more efficient.
Lastly, consider the mode of transportation when packing books. If you are using a moving truck or shipping service, be aware of their weight restrictions. This knowledge can help you adjust your packing strategy accordingly. If necessary, consider splitting your collection into multiple shipments to comply with weight regulations.
